  1. Coordinated Universal Time or UTC is the primary time standard globally used to regulate clocks and time. It establishes a reference for the current time, forming the basis for civil time and time zones. UTC facilitates international communication, navigation, scientific research, and commerce.

  2. Coordinated Universal Time (or UTC) is the standard time system of the world. It is the standard by which the world regulates clocks and time. It is, within about 1 second, mean solar time at 0° longitude. The standard before was Greenwich Mean Time (GMT). UTC and GMT are almost the same.

  6. Mar 28, 2024 · Coordinated Universal Time (UTC), international basis of civil and scientific time, which was introduced on January 1, 1960.   7. A Standard, Not a Time Zone. UTC is the time standard commonly used across the world. The world's timing centers have agreed to keep their time scales closely synchronized - or coordinated - therefore the name Coordinated Universal Time. Understanding UTC offsets.
